theres a freeze in the treatment of warts, called freezaway but use it on the moon, Heres what it says in the instructions ...
Do not use on moles, birthmarks, warts with hair from the, genital (penis or vaginal areas) warts or warts on the face or mucous membranes (eg mouth, nose, anus, genitals, lips, ears, eyes or nearby). The use in these areas, it can cause burns and permanent scars on the skin or blindness.

Go to a dermatologist, maybe they can do something about the laser therapy or carving out, but they are treated only a doctor with him, not even in the pharmacy treatment
